Your Role
As an Associate Dentist at Legacy Dental, you’ll provide comprehensive dental care to a diverse patient base while working alongside a collaborative and experienced team. Your responsibilities will include:
Diagnosing and treating a wide range of dental conditions
Performing restorative and preventive procedures
Collaborating with hygienists and specialists to create effective treatment plans
Educating patients about oral health, treatment options, and aftercare
Maintaining accurate and thorough clinical documentation
Staying current with the latest dental techniques and best practices
Qualifications
D.D.S. or D.M.D. degree from an accredited dental school
Active Minnesota dental license in good standing (or eligibility to obtain)
Strong diagnostic and clinical skills
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ities
A patient-first mindset with a commitment to quality care
Comfortable with dental technology and eager to learn
